The Alden in McLean will present Les Ballets Trokadero de Monte Carlo, better known as "The Trocks," for two performances at 8 p.m. on Wednesday and Thursday, Jan. 18 and 19. Tickets are $45, $35 for tax district residents. The theatre is located at 1234 Ingleside Avenue.

The cross-dressing, all-male troupe will perform its fusion of classical ballet and slapstick humor at the Alden. On the surface, the show is a witty and somewhat campy send-up of classical ballet conventions, but just underneath there is a seriousness of purpose and a love of the art form. Similarly the dancers-"ballerinas" in size 10 pointe shoes with names like Svetlana Lofatkina and Ida Nevasayneva-are superb, with a level of technique that would top that of many of their female counterparts. By enhancing rather than mocking the spirit of dance, "The Trocks" delight and amuse the most knowledgeable dance enthusiasts, as well as novices. The New York Times called the company's performances "accessible to balletomanes and neophytes, and wholly spectacular."
